Andy Newman / New York Times:
Two Wikipedia contributors disarmed a gunman who threatened to kill himself at WikiConference to protest a policy banning editors who identify as pedophiles  —  After the man walked onto the stage at the “Wiki World's Fair” event and threatened to kill himself, witnesses said, two members of the audience jumped in to stop him.
